UTICA, N.Y. – The Plattsburgh State men's track and field placed fourth at the Pioneer Spring Invite scoring 65.5 points. The Cardinals had six top-three finishes on the day.
Noah Bonesteel (Averill Park, N.Y. / Averill Park) posted an AARTFC qualifying mark in the 5,000-meter run as he finished second and set a new personal best with a time of 15:10.95 and collected eight points.
Brexton Montville (Cadyville, N.Y. / Saranac) won the 200-meter dash as he set a new personal best with a time of 22.03 seconds and collected 10 points for the Cardinals while
Michael Brockway (Washingtonville, N.Y. / Washingtonville) won the 10,000-meter run and posted a 33:20.59 time to collect 10 points as well.
Charles Cypress (New Windsor, N.Y. / Cornwall) finished second in the 100-meter dash to collect eight points and set a new personal best time of 10.78 seconds while Montville scored five points in the 100-meter dash as he finished fourth with a time of 10.88 seconds.
Erik Kucera (Mount Sinai, N.Y. / Mount Sinai) had a strong showing in the 3,000-meter steeplechase with a second-place finish and a time of 9:55.02 as he earned eight points. The 4x100-meter relay team of
Jordan Williams (Bronx, N.Y. / Cardinal Hayes),
Justin Rushia (Warrensburg, N.Y. / Warrensburg),
Ryan Williams (Brooklyn, N.Y. / South Shore), and
Julius James (Bronx, N.Y. / Cardinal Hayes) placed second with a time of 44.92 seconds and earned eight points.
Nathan Alexander also collected two points in the 3,000-meter steeplechase as he posted a time of 10:49.07.
Graham Richard (Albany, N.Y. / Albany) collected a point on the day with an eighth-place finish in the 5,000-meter run as he posted a time of 15:48.82 which was a new personal best for the first-year distance runner. As well as collecting points in the 4x100-meter relay, Rushia also posted a new personal best in the 100-meter dash posting a 11.54-second mark.
Aidan Masten (Peru, N.Y. / Seton Catholic) and
Evan Rando (Saratoga Springs, N.Y. / Saratoga Springs) both placed sixth in their respective events. Masten had a 6.46-meter jump in the long jump as he earned three points and Rondo jumped 1.74 meters in the high jump and earned 2.5 points
.
Aidan Lobdell (Westport, N.Y. / Bouquet Valley) and
Zander Brown (Wappingers Falls, N.Y. / Roy C. Ketcham) both set new personal bests on the day. Lobdell upgraded his mark in the 100-meter dash with a 11.74-second mark and Brown upgraded his mark in the 1,500-meter run to 4:33.66.
Plattsburgh State is next in action on Friday, Apr 12 as they head to RPI for the RPI Under the Lights Invitational.
